Google maakt de Interactions API de standaardmethode voor het bouwen met Gemini Agents

Google verandert de manier waarop je met Gemini bouwt.

De Interactions API is nu algemeen beschikbaar. Het is nu de primaire manier om met Gemini-modellen en -agents te werken.

Dit is een grote verschuiving voor ontwikkelaars. Google beweegt naar een 'agent-first' benadering. Hoewel de oude generateContent API nog steeds werkt, zullen nieuwe agent-functies eerst op de Interactions API verschijnen.

Belangrijkste kenmerken van de Interactions API:

• Eén endpoint voor alles. Gebruik een model ID voor eenvoudige taken of een agent ID voor langdurige taken. • Managed Agents. Eén API-aanroep zet een Linux-sandbox op. De agent kan code uitvoeren, het web doorzoeken en bestanden beheren. • Achtergrondtaken. Stel background=True in om langdurige taken uit te voeren zonder te wachten. • Tool mixing. Combineer Google Search en Google Maps met je eigen functies in één verzoek. • Deep Research. Krijg betere snelheid en diepgang met native grafieken en multimodale ondersteuning voor afbeeldingen en PDF's. • Media-generatie. Toegang tot afbeeldingen-, muziek- en text-to-speech-tools. • Kostenbeheersing. Gebruik Flex- of Priority-niveaus. Het Flex-niveau biedt 50% lagere kosten. • State retention. Betaalde gebruikers hebben 55 dagen toegang tot eerdere interacties.

De architectuur verandert ook. Google stapt af van oude berichtformaten. Elke stap is nu een getypeerde actie, zoals gebruikersinvoer, gedachte of functieaanroep.

Wat moet je doen?

Als je een nieuw Gemini-project start, gebruik dan de Interactions API.

Als je een bestaande app hebt, laat deze dan gewoon draaien. Maar controleer je workflows. Kijk of je achtergronduitvoering of managed agents nodig hebt.

Controleer je SDK's. Google ondersteunt partners zoals LiteLLM, Eigent en Agno.

Houd je kosten in de gaten. Test het Flex-niveau voor workloads waarbij snelheid minder belangrijk is dan de prijs.

Let op: Managed Agents draaien aan de kant van Google. Bekijk het gedrag van de sandbox en de gegevensbeheersing als je met gevoelige gegevens werkt.

Google schakelt de oude API niet uit. Ze laten je de toekomst zien. Als je op het oude pad blijft bouwen, mis je mogelijk de beste nieuwe functies.

Bron: https://blog.google/innovation-and-ai/technology/developers-tools/interactions-api-general-availability/

Optionele leercommunity: https://t.me/GyaanSetuAi